About A Coruña

A Coruña, located in the northwest of Spain, offers a blend of history, culture, and natural beauty that appeals to many visitors. One of the most notable landmarks is the Tower of Hercules, an ancient Roman lighthouse that has been recognized as a UNESCO World Heritage site. Its views over the Atlantic Ocean are particularly striking, making it a worthwhile visit.

The Old Town (Ciudad Vieja) is another highlight, characterized by its narrow streets and charming squares. Here, you can explore the historic architecture, including the Church of Santiago, which is a significant part of the city's heritage. Strolling through this area provides a glimpse into the local life and history.

For those interested in art and culture, the Museo de Bellas Artes houses an impressive collection of artworks, including pieces from Spanish masters. Additionally, the Casa de las Ciencias offers interactive exhibits that focus on science and technology, making it a great stop for families.

The coastline is also a major draw. The Beaches of A Coruña, such as Riazor and Orzán, are perfect for a leisurely day by the sea, where you can enjoy the local atmosphere and perhaps partake in some water sports. The promenade along the coast is ideal for walking or cycling, providing a scenic route that showcases the city’s maritime charm.

Food lovers will appreciate the local cuisine, particularly the seafood. Dining at a traditional marisquería allows you to sample fresh dishes, including octopus and various shellfish, which are staples in Galician gastronomy.

Lastly, if you're interested in local traditions, visiting during the Festas de María Pita in August can offer insight into the cultural celebrations that honor one of the city's historical figures. Engaging with the local community during these events can enhance your understanding of A Coruña's heritage. Each of these experiences contributes to a well-rounded visit to this vibrant city.
